this street/strip coupe to run at our local 1/8th & 1/4 mile track. This video is when it was getting dyno tuned at Powertrain Dynamics by Steve(local). The car put down 315rwhp and 398rwtq with only about 200 miles on the engine.
mods: GT 40 Tublar intake, GT 40 heads ported/polished by Ben Alameda(famous local racer), Isky custom grind cam, mac unequal length headers with matching h pipe and catback. on the ignition side resides a whole msd ignition set up and an autologic(omg so old...lol) custom chip. All on a 5.0 bored over 0.30.

This car does not have 398 RWTQ period
Power is probably correct.
If TQ was correct, that car should be Quite a bit faster in the 1/8th with more MPH
my stock E7 setup did 85-86 in the 1/8th
That torque is 331/347 territory, unless the car is running no accessories and possibly being dynoed in 3rd gear.
